The CAS Registry Mumber 6411-96-7 includes 7 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 4 digits, 6,4,1 and 1 respectively; the second part has 2 digits, 9 and 6 respectively. Calculate Digit Verification of CAS Registry Number 6411-96: (6*6)+(5*4)+(4*1)+(3*1)+(2*9)+(1*6)=87 87 % 10 = 7 So 6411-96-7 is a valid CAS Registry Number.
